The Relationship Between News Events and Market Volatility
News events have a significant impact on market volatility, often leading traders to make quick decisions in response to breaking information. For instance, economic indicators, such as employment rates and inflation figures, can lead to immediate shifts in stock prices and cryptocurrency valuations. Traders closely monitor these reports, as they provide insight into the overall health of the economy and potential future performance, which can dictate buying or selling strategies. Additionally, geopolitical events, such as elections, trade agreements, and conflicts, can create uncertainty in the markets. When news emerges regarding trade tensions or regulatory changes, traders react rapidly, adjusting their positions based on perceived risks and opportunities. This reaction can exacerbate price movements, making it crucial for traders to stay informed and responsive to the latest developments, especially in the cryptocurrency market, which is often more volatile than traditional assets.
The influence of news events is particularly pronounced in high-frequency trading, where algorithms are designed to react instantly to news releases. Traders leveraging these technologies can capitalize on fleeting opportunities created by news fluctuations. For example, a sudden announcement about a significant partnership within the cryptocurrency space can lead to price surges, making the ability to react swiftly critical for profit maximization.
Types of News That Impact Trading Decisions
Different types of news events affect trading decisions in various ways. Economic data releases, like GDP growth or interest rate changes, are pivotal for traders. These indicators inform their outlook on market performance, affecting asset allocation strategies. For instance, a stronger-than-expected jobs report may encourage investors to buy stocks, believing that a robust economy will drive corporate profits higher.
In the world of cryptocurrency, news related to regulatory developments is particularly influential. Announcements of regulatory scrutiny or compliance from governments can have immediate effects on prices. For instance, news about a country banning cryptocurrency transactions can lead to a sharp decline in market values, while favorable regulations can propel prices upward. Traders must be adept at interpreting these announcements to make informed choices.
Moreover, sentiment-driven news, such as public statements from influential figures in the crypto space, can shift market perceptions and drive trading behavior. For example, a tweet from a prominent entrepreneur about a particular cryptocurrency can cause a rapid rise in its value, demonstrating how public sentiment can lead to large price fluctuations. Understanding the nuances of these news types can provide traders with a strategic advantage.
The Importance of Real-time News Monitoring
To navigate the complexities of trading influenced by news events, real-time news monitoring is essential. Traders often use specialized tools and platforms that provide instant updates on news developments. This capability allows them to react promptly to market-moving information, enhancing their ability to capitalize on short-term trends. Quick access to reliable news sources is vital in maintaining a competitive edge in volatile markets.
Traders often utilize social media platforms and news aggregators to gauge market sentiment and receive real-time updates. By following influential accounts and subscribing to alerts, they can stay informed about critical events that may affect their trading decisions. For example, traders in cryptocurrency markets may closely follow discussions on platforms like Twitter or Reddit to catch emerging trends before they become mainstream.
Additionally, traders who utilize tools that analyze news sentiment can gain insights into how the market might react to various news events. These analytic tools can assess the overall tone of news articles and social media posts, helping traders make informed predictions about market movements based on collective sentiment. Such insights can empower traders to refine their strategies and improve their decision-making processes.
Risk Management in the Face of News Events
Effective risk management is crucial when trading during news events, as unexpected outcomes can lead to significant losses. Traders need to develop strategies that account for the heightened volatility that often accompanies major news releases. Implementing stop-loss orders can mitigate risks by automatically closing positions when prices reach a predetermined level, helping to protect capital during turbulent market conditions.
Traders should also be cautious about over-leveraging, especially when news events are imminent. The allure of high potential returns can lead to excessive risk-taking, which may result in substantial losses if the market moves against them. Understanding market dynamics and setting realistic expectations can help traders navigate the uncertain waters of trading influenced by news events.
Moreover, diversifying a portfolio can serve as a buffer against the risks posed by sudden news shifts. By spreading investments across different assets, traders can minimize the impact of negative news on a single asset. This approach allows for a more balanced risk exposure and can provide a cushion in volatile market conditions, ensuring that no single event can dramatically derail an investment strategy.
Enhancing Trading Strategies with News Insights
Traders can significantly enhance their strategies by integrating news insights into their decision-making processes. By conducting thorough analysis and developing models that consider historical responses to similar news events, traders can create informed predictions about potential market movements. This analytical approach can help traders identify entry and exit points more effectively during volatile periods.
Additionally, backtesting trading strategies against historical news events can provide insights into how certain assets typically respond to specific types of news. For instance, if a trader notices that a cryptocurrency tends to spike following regulatory clarity, they might position themselves to capitalize on similar future announcements. This disciplined approach to strategy development can lead to more consistent trading outcomes.
Finally, understanding the psychological aspect of trading is essential. Traders need to recognize that the market is often driven by emotions and reactions to news, leading to irrational price movements. Maintaining a level-headed approach, regardless of market hype or fear, can be beneficial in making rational trading decisions that are based on analysis rather than emotions.
